#408a58 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#408a58 is composed of 25.1% red, 54.1%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 53.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 36.2% yellow and 45.9% black. It has a hue angle of 139.5 degrees, a saturation of 36.6% and a lightness of 39.6%. #408a58 color hex could be obtained by blending #80ffb0 with #001500.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

Shades and Tints of #408a58

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020403 is the darkest color, while #f6fbf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#408a58

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5f6b63 is the less saturated color, while #02c842 is the most saturated one.
